USDA Investing $110 Million to Improve Rural Healthcare
Earlier this week, USDA Rural Development Undersecretary Xochitl Torres Small announced that the agency is awarding $110 million in grants to improve healthcare facilities in rural towns across America.  These grants will help 208 rural healthcare organizations expand critical services for five million people in 43 states and Guam.   “...

Rural Care Economic Challenges
"Since 2010, 135 rural hospitals have closed and an additional 453 are vulnerable to closure," said Rural Development's Xochitl Torres Small as she testified recently before the Senate Ag Committee as they looked at opportunities and challenges in the rural care economy ...

Lawmakers Ask Health Department to Send Aid to Rural Hospitals
A coalition of lawmakers is asking the Health and Human Services Department to provide immediate assistance to rural hospitals and clinics. In a letter to Health and Human Services Secretary Alex Azar, 122 lawmakers asked the Trump administration to provide financial aid included in the CARES Act to help rural hospitals during the COVID-19 outbreak ...
